Releases: modern-python/lite-bootstrap
Releases · modern-python/lite-bootstrap
0.28.0
What's Changed
- fix: cache OpenTelemetryMiddleware in litestar instrumentation by @lesnik512 in #80
- Fix/low severity cleanups by @lesnik512 in #81
- fix: preserve teardown error detail via TeardownError exception by @lesnik512 in #82
- perf: hoist OTel import in tracer_injection to module level by @lesnik512 in #83
- refactor: declare opentelemetry_service_name/namespace on PyroscopeCo… by @lesnik512 in #84
- feat: add logging_enabled flag, decouple from service_debug by @lesnik512 in #85
- feat: unify instrument skip feedback through warning subclasses by @lesnik512 in #86
Full Changelog: 0.27.1...0.28.0
0.27.1
What's Changed
- feat: make TimeStamper configurable in LoggingConfig by @lesnik512 in #79
Full Changelog: 0.27.0...0.27.1
0.27.0
What's Changed
- feat: integrate litestar StructlogPlugin for request.logger support by @lesnik512 in #78
Full Changelog: 0.26.1...0.27.0
0.26.1
What's Changed
- fix: set faststream log level on logger before injecting into broker by @lesnik512 in #77
Full Changelog: 0.26.0...0.26.1
0.26.0
What's Changed
- Feat/faststream structlog logger by @lesnik512 in #76
Full Changelog: 0.25.4...0.26.0
0.25.4
What's Changed
- fix teardown isolation, OTel provider init order, and FastAPI install… by @lesnik512 in #75
Full Changelog: 0.25.3...0.25.4
0.25.3
0.25.2
0.25.1
0.25.0
What's Changed
- use route template for Litestar OTel span naming by @lesnik512 in #70
- add pyroscope instrument by @lesnik512 in #71
Full Changelog: 0.24.1...0.25.0